MSR Lightning Ascent Snowshoe - Men's

I am using the shoes in Colorado and they have performed extremely well. They are especially stable in steep climbs.
They are , also, light and the flotation is quite good in deep powder.
I have not tried to pack them but they appear to be well designed for this purpose, light, relatively small and easy to get in and out.
My only criticism is the rear strap will not stay at the same location. Perhaps I am not using it properly. Once they are on the bindings stay put and are very well designed.
Overall, I would rate them a Five Star and very superior to my experience in owning Red Feather and Sherpa shoes

Tech Specs:

Frame Material:
aircraft-grade aluminum 
Binding System:
PosiLock (AT binding) 
Crampon Material:
aircraft-grade aluminum, stainless steel 
Deck Material:
urethane 
Binding Material:
PosiLock (3 toe straps, 1 heel) 
Snowshoe Weight:
[22 in ] 3 lb 13 oz; [25 in ] 3 lb 15 oz; [30 in ] 4 lb 7 oz 
Recommended User Weight:
[22 in] 100 - 180 lb; [25 in] 120 - 220; [30 in] 150 - 280 
Recommended Use:
winter backcountry adventures over rugged, uneven terrain 
Manufacturer Warranty:
lifetime
